About
Tower Bridge, Pittencrieff Park, Dunfermline is a category B listed building-listed bridge in scotland-central, United Kingdom, registered on the Historic Environment Scotland register (entry LB25967). Listed status protects buildings and structures of special architectural or historic interest. See the linked Wikipedia article for further details.
